Just finished watching a BBC Click Report on Windows Vista...heres what they had too say about it.
It will come in 3 different versions..BASIC ,HOME and ULTIMATE. If you get the Basic version,you can upgrade to Ultimate,with the same disc,but will have to pay a fee to Microsoft for doing this. Each version will come in 2 different types 32 BIT and 64 BIT. The 32 Bit version can read 80% of all software out there at the moment,whereas the 64 BIT can only read around 60%. If you try to hack,tamper or modify the Vista system,then it has a built in security feature that slowly crashes the programme,and you have to send it back to Microsoft for them to load a new version (which they cost you for) While on the subject of security ........ The Vista cames with the most advanced security programme buit into an operating system (so Microsift say) ,which in the long run will be great...BUT...at present if you try to install a new piece of hardware on the system,then it wont work as,microsoft sercurity wont beable to read the drivers for it.This is because the system relays on the latest drivers from the manufactor,which they are in the progress of rewriting ,and wont be 100% finished ,untill at least, 18 months from now. All this is because Microsoft want to keep the system as firewall and security safe as possible,at the cost and annoyance of the consumer. Anyways just though I would share this with you.
